Bankroll Tips for $1, $5 and $10 Deposits
Small deposits need smart bet sizing. If you deposit $1 AUD and choose $0.20 spins, you only have five spins before the balance is gone. That does not give you much room to experience a game. A better approach is to match stake size to session length.
- With $1 AUD, use the lowest available stake and treat it as a cashier test.
- With $5 AUD, divide the balance into 50–100 small rounds where possible.
- With $10 AUD, set a stop-loss before claiming any bonus.
- With bonus funds, check the maximum bet rule because exceeding it can void winnings.
A useful rule is to keep each spin or round below 1%–2% of your available balance when possible. This does not guarantee results, but it reduces the chance of ending the session too quickly.
Important Limits, KYC and Withdrawal Reality
Low deposits can make access easy, but withdrawals still require compliance. Before cashing out, players may need to complete KYC checks, including identity, address, and payment ownership verification. If your first deposit was made through a voucher or crypto wallet, extra checks may apply because the casino must confirm the account holder and source of funds.
Withdrawal timing can also differ from deposit speed. PayID deposits may be near-instant, but cash-outs might still take 24 hours for approval plus additional bank processing time. Card withdrawals may take 1–3 business days after internal review. Crypto can be quick once approved, but network congestion may affect delivery.
Another detail many players miss is the withdrawal cap on bonus winnings. A small-deposit bonus may include a maximum cashout such as $50, $100, or 5x the deposit. If you claim Slotozen Casino $1 get $20, read the maximum conversion rule before you start playing.

Responsible Gambling AU: Keep Low Deposits Low Risk
Low-deposit play should remain entertainment, not a way to recover losses. Use Responsible Gambling AU principles before making any deposit: set a budget, use time limits, avoid gambling while stressed, and never borrow money to play. If available, activate deposit limits, session reminders, cooling-off periods, or self-exclusion tools directly in your account.
If gambling stops feeling controlled, contact Australian support services such as Gambling Help Online. A low minimum deposit is only beneficial when it helps you stay within a planned entertainment budget.
